A Beautiful Child

In Hebrews 11:23, the Bible says Moses’ parents hid him and protected his life “because they saw that the child was beautiful.” Beyond this particular circumstance with Moses, what could be said for all children?

What makes for a beautiful child?

  1. Just the child itself—the mere existence of a little one made in the image of God is beautiful (Gen. 1:26-27; 9:6). All children are precious and of infinite worth / value—this means in the womb or out and includes all nationalities and colors.
  2. A child is also beautiful when we step back and see the way they fit into God’s plan—wherever that may be! Moses was special because he was chosen by the Lord to lead Israel out of slavery and into a new era. Each child has the potential to make special contributions to the church of Jesus Christ.
  3. A child is beautiful when they are seen in the dynamic of a loving and trusting relationship. So many need to be shown love and mercy. They need someone to protect them and to show them the life and message of Jesus. Raising a child in the nurture and admonition of the Lord is beautiful (Eph. 6:4).
